A new variant of vacuum arc ion source is described whereby the problems of short cathode lifetime and low charge states, commonly found for low boiling point cathode materials, are avoided. This novel source embodiment has been operated using bismuth as the wanted ionic species. It was found that the ion charge state spectrum can be improved (i.e., increased) significantly, with the charge state of maximum amplitude being increased from Bi1+to Bi3+, and the number of pulses that were obtained before the cathode needed changing was 108.
